Actionscript 3 基于“如果”设置日期选择器“事件”

Actionscript 3 基于“如果”设置日期选择器“事件”,actionscript-3,flash-builder,flex4.6,datechooser,Actionscript 3,Flash Builder,Flex4.6,Datechooser,我正在开发的应用程序中有一个日期选择器;该应用程序将提交时间卡 我正试图找出一种根据提交的小时数设置颜色的方法,即红色表示少于8小时,绿色表示正好8小时,黄色表示多于8小时。我已经有了那天从quick base抽出的小时数作为一个数字。是否将其设置为类似的值 if (hoursDateSelected <= 7){ calendar.something = green } 这可能就是您正在寻找的: 基本上,它是在扩展组件。也许我读得不对,但你想设置什么对象的颜色?是否在已计算小时数

我正在开发的应用程序中有一个日期选择器;该应用程序将提交时间卡

我正试图找出一种根据提交的小时数设置颜色的方法,即红色表示少于8小时,绿色表示正好8小时,黄色表示多于8小时。我已经有了那天从quick base抽出的小时数作为一个数字。是否将其设置为类似的值

if (hoursDateSelected <= 7){
   calendar.something = green
}

这可能就是您正在寻找的:


基本上,它是在扩展组件。

也许我读得不对,但你想设置什么对象的颜色?是否在已计算小时数的位置选择了HoursDate?我认为您的思路是正确的,但是没有更多的代码/解释,我不能确定。在日期选择器上,hoursDateSelected是hrsSo。您要在日期选择器上更改的颜色到底是什么?选定的日期?今天?约会范围?我们就快到了。基于if的日期,我有一个arrayCollection,上面有日期和小时数。因此,颜色将在当前月份的各个日期显示。